Contexte culturel

In Turkey, guests are considered 'Tanrı Misafiri' (God's Guest). If a guest breaks something, the host must use 'Canın sağ olsun' to ensure the guest feels no shame. Fans often use 'Canınız sağ olsun' for their team after a hard-fought loss to show that they still support the players despite the result. In small businesses (esnaf culture), if a customer realizes they are short on change, the shopkeeper might say 'Canın sağ olsun, sonra verirsin' to build trust. The phrase reflects the belief that the 'Can' (soul) is a loan from God, and material objects are temporary. Forgiving a mistake is a way to honor the soul.

🎯

The Smile Factor

Always say this with a warm smile. The tone of voice is what makes it sincere rather than sarcastic.

⚠️

Not for Thanks

Never use this to say 'You're welcome.' It will sound like you are forgiving them for being nice to you!

💬

Plurality Matters

Use 'Canınız sağ olsun' for elders or strangers to show extra respect while being kind.

💡

Texting Shortcut

In texts, people sometimes just write 'Canın sağolsun' (one word), though two words is grammatically correct.

Aides visuelles

Canın Sağ Olsun vs. Sağlık Olsun

Canın Sağ Olsun
Personal mistake You broke it
Focus on YOU Your soul
Sağlık Olsun
General bad luck The rain ruined the party
Focus on SITUATION General health
